As she likes it

Article Abstract:

Hong Kong art-film director Ann Hui's focus is social sensitivity, as illustrated in her latest release, called 18 Springs. The movie is based on a novel by Eileen Chang, set in prewar Shanghai, and features Leon Lai and Wu Chien-lien. Born in China in 1947, Hui worked in television before beginning her directing career in 1979. Her first international success came in 1982 with Boat People and Hui became known as one of Hong Kong's leading 'new wave' directors.Hui has always insisted that the films she makes are meaningful to her and she often tackles subjects that others avoid.

The homecoming

Article Abstract:

Wayne Wang a Hong Kong filmmaker with a western orientation is filming a picture about inter-racial romance within the context of international politics. The film is about the return of Hong Kong to Chinese rule and its impact on the lives of an Asian girl and her western lover.
